What Are Custom Backlit Membrane Switches?

Custom backlit membrane switches are multi-layer laminated control panels manufactured entirely according to customer drawings, functional requirements and application scenarios. They retain the core sealed structure of standard membrane switches — graphic overlay, spacer layer, tactile layer, circuit layer and adhesive backing — with the addition of a custom-configured light distribution layer and integrated LED components.

The key difference from standard products is that every parameter is adjustable. Instead of adapting your equipment to a generic keypad, the panel is engineered to fit your device shell, operating environment and user needs exactly. This results in better assembly fit, higher reliability and stronger product differentiation.

Full Customization Dimensions

We support end-to-end customization across every structural and functional dimension. The table below summarizes all available options:

Customization Category

Available Options

Typical Application Scenarios

Graphic Overlay

Autotex PET, SABIC PC, anti-UV, antibacterial, matte/glossy, anti-glare

Medical devices, outdoor terminals, consumer appliances

Backlight System

Side LED + LGF, direct per-key LED, EL film, RGB multi-color, selective key lighting

Medical monitors, industrial panels, gaming devices, smart home

Tactile Feedback

Metal dome (crisp click), polyester dome (silent), non-tactile, custom actuation force

Industrial control, medical equipment, office devices

Protection Rating

IP54, IP65, IP67, IP68 fully sealed

Indoor consumer, industrial factory, outdoor equipment, wash-down scenarios

Circuit Type

Printed PET, rigid PCB, flexible FPC, ESD protected

Standard keypads, high-precision instruments, curved panels

Electronic Integration

LEDs, connectors, resistors, capacitors, PCBA, display windows

Complex control panels, intelligent terminals, medical devices

Brand & Shape

Custom outer contour, custom key layout, logo printing, Pantone color matching

Branded consumer products, private mold equipment

Industry-Specific Custom Solutions

Custom backlit membrane switches are engineered to meet the unique demands of each industry:

Medical & Healthcare

Medical devices require antibacterial surfaces, alcohol-resistant overlays and soft non-glare illumination for low-light wards and operating rooms. We customize medical-grade panels with biocompatible materials, IP65+ sealing and uniform backlighting, with full documentation for equipment registration.

Industrial Control

Factory automation, CNC machines and outdoor terminals face dust, oil, vibration and temperature swings. We build rugged custom panels with IP65–IP68 sealing, vibration-resistant circuits, wide-temperature materials and crisp tactile feedback optimized for gloved operation.

Automotive & Transportation

In-vehicle and roadside equipment must withstand extreme temperatures, UV exposure and long-term vibration. Our custom automotive solutions use temperature-stabilized materials, anti-UV overlays and reinforced lamination for reliable outdoor performance.

Consumer & Smart Home

Consumer and smart home products prioritize brand identity, aesthetic appeal and cost efficiency. We customize brand-matched colors, exclusive logos, selective backlighting and silent tactile options, with cost-optimized designs for mass production.

Common Customization Pitfalls to Avoid

  1. Over-pursuing ultra-thin design Extreme thinness often compromises backlight uniformity and structural durability. For industrial and medical applications, prioritize performance and reliability over minimal thickness.

  2. Only comparing tooling cost Low initial tooling fees often come with higher per-unit costs and lower yield in mass production. Evaluate total project cost, not just upfront tooling charges.

  3. Skipping DFM review Unoptimized designs frequently lead to low production yield, high defect rates and repeated mold modifications. Early DFM review typically reduces total project cost by 15–30%.

  4. Ignoring batch color consistency Without standardized color control, different production batches may show visible color differences. We use unified Pantone matching and LED binning to ensure consistent appearance across all orders.

  5. Over-specifying protection grade IP65 is sufficient for most indoor industrial and medical scenarios. Specifying IP68 for products that never face immersion adds unnecessary sealing cost.
